Machine Operator – 1st shift and 3rd Shift
Position Summary
The Heavy Milling Operator is a cross-functional position responsible for supporting all major operations within the Heavy Milling Department, including saw operations, edge banding, panel processing, and specialty part production. The role directly impacts customer satisfaction and company profitability.
Due to the physical demands of this position, proper lifting techniques, body mechanics, and safe work practices must be consistently utilized.
Essential Functions
Review and organize production paperwork, work orders, invoices, and Kan Ban cards.
Set up, program, operate, and monitor production equipment.
Verify materials, wood species, and production specifications prior to processing.
Perform cutting, drilling, grooving, edge banding, notching, and other machining operations as required.
Conduct first-piece, in-process, and final quality inspections.
Identify and correct quality issues, defects, and process deviations.
Maintain production standards while meeting daily output goals.
Follow all company safety, quality, and operational procedures.
Maintain a clean, organized, and safe work environment.
Perform other duties as assigned.
Physical Requirements
Lift, carry, push up to 50 pounds, and pull up to 75 pounds occasionally.
Frequently handle materials weighing 10 to 25 pounds.
Perform frequent reaching, lifting, pushing, pulling, bending, twisting, walking, and standing.
Work with cabinet components, wood panels, and sheet goods of varying sizes and weights.
Maintain productivity in a fast-paced manufacturing environment.
Knowledge of metric and standard measurements and effective use and understanding of calipers
Equipment Used
Saws and cutting equipment
Edge banding equipment
Panel processing and notching equipment
Computers and production control systems
Material handling equipment
Roller carts, pallets, and lift tables
Hand tools and measuring devices
